IAR Embedded Workbench integriert neues Analysetool ULP Advisor™ von Texas Instruments |
Uppsala, Schweden – 31. Mai 2012 – IAR Embedded Workbench für MSP430, die leistungsstarke Embedded Software Entwicklungs-Toolsuite von IAR Systems, integriert das neue Codeanalyse-Softwaretool ULP Advisor von Texas Instruments (TI). IAR Systems ist damit der einzige unabhängige Toolanbieter, der eine derartige Integration anbietet. Embedded Software-Entwickler profitieren dabei sowohl von den praktischen Features der ULP Advisor Software als auch von den Vorteilen der leistungsstarken Optimierungen durch den IAR C/C++ Compiler sowie der nutzerfreundlichen Entwicklungsumgebung der IAR Embedded Workbench. Der ULP Advisor von TI ist ein Analysetool für die Entwicklung von energieeffizienten Anwendungen. Anhand einer statischen Code-Analyse untersucht es den Softwarecode und gibt Entwicklern Codezeile für Codezeile Tipps und Tricks für die Codeoptimierung zur Minimierung der Stromaufnahme und zur Optimierung der Ultra-Low-Power-Performance. Das Tool prüft dazu den Code systematisch nach Verstößen gegen die Regeln des Ultra-Low-Power-Designs ab. Jeder Regelverstoß wird markiert und in einer Liste aufgezeichnet. Per Click auf den jeweiligen Listenpunkt findet der Entwickler sofort den betreffenden Codeblock, der einen erhöhten Stromverbrauch auslösen könnte, und erhält einen Vorschlag, wie sich der Code an dieser Stelle für eine möglichst geringe Stromaufnahme optimieren lässt. Mit der Integration in die IAR Embedded Workbench kann der Entwickler den ULP Advisor von Texas Instruments innerhalb seiner gewohnten Entwicklungsumgebung nutzen. Die ausgewählten Regeln werden bei jedem Build geprüft und das Ergebnis wird im Build-Protokoll angezeigt. Zu dem neuen Tool existiert auch ein ausführliches Wiki mit Informationen speziell zu jeder Ultra-Low-Power-Regel sowie auch Hintergrundinfos, zum Beispiel weshalb die jeweilige Regel so wichtig ist und was das Tool prüft, bevor es eine Anmerkung im Code hinterlässt. IAR Embedded Workbench für MSP430 ist ein umfangreiches und zuverlässiges Toolset für den Aufbau und das Debugging von Embedded Systemen basierend auf der Ultra-Low-Power 16-Bit-Mikrocontroller-Familie MSP430 von Texas Instruments. IAR Embedded Workbench beinhaltet einen hochoptimierenden C/C++ Compiler und eine nutzerfreundliche Entwicklungsumgebung mit Projektmanager, Editor, Build-Tools und Debugger. Evaluierungsversionen stehen zum Download bereit unter www.iar.com/ew430. |
Über IAR Systems IAR Systems ist der weltweit führende Anbieter für Softwaretools zur Entwicklung von Embedded Systems Anwendungen. Die Softwaretools ermöglichen es über 14.000 großen, mittelständischen und kleinen Unternehmen Premium-Produkte basierend auf 8-, 16- und 32-bit Mikrocontrollern zu entwickeln, vor allem in den Branchen industrielle Automation, Medizintechnik, Konsumerelektronik, Telekommunikation und Automotive. IAR Systems verfügt über ein weitreichendes Netzwerk von Partnern und arbeitet mit den weltweit führenden Halbleiteranbietern zusammen. Die IAR Systems Group AP ist an der NASDAQ OMX Stockholm gelistet. Weitere Informationen zu IAR Systems unter www.iar.com. Hinweis: IAR Systems, IAR Embedded Workbench, C-SPY, visualSTATE, The Code to Success, IAR KickStart Kit, I-jet, IAR und das Logo von IAR Systems sind Markenzeichen bzw. eingetragene Markenzeichen von IAR Systems AB. Alle weiteren Produkte sind Markenzeichen ihrer jeweiligen Eigentümer. |